I just wanted to take the time to say how impressed I am with coach Partridge sticking to his open door policy. I am the Interfraternity Council President at FAU and contacted him about setting up a meeting. He had his secretary contact me 2 days later and allowed me to set up a meeting at a day and time was convenient for me this week. As for the meeting, most of you may not know but one of the things Pelini did right was reach out to FAU's fraternities and sororities asking for us personally in our chapter meetings to show up in full force at games. After he was fired, Brian Wright came in personally as well. I plan on making sure that relationship continues because they always came in and personally asked us students what ideas we had to make games exciting, boost attendance, and create traditions because they saw potential in our organizations, who are loyal fans. One of the things they implemented was a greek seating section in the lower half of the endzone that you may have noticed was the camera man's favorite spot to film in the student section because it was always packed and rowdy. I am glad he is making himself available to organization leaders here on campus!
